Mama Projects is pleased to present a new sculpture by Nicki Cherry for the Sculpture section of NADA New York 2025. 

Cherry’s sculptural practice explores the tension between growth and decay, embodiment and fragmentation. Their works often appear in a state of transformation, composed of amorphous, figurative structures made from materials such as pigmented concrete, fiberglass, wax, and ceramic. These forms are sometimes fragmented across the floor or left visibly incomplete, with limbs or heads deliberately altered or absent. 

These visceral forms are punctuated with both organic and synthetic elements—live and artificial flowers, medical tubing, handlebars, rubber components, and functioning pumps that circulate liquid through the works. Through this integration, Cherry stages a kind of choreography between material and body, evoking the ongoing shifts we experience within ourselves—physically, emotionally, and physiologically.
